What Is Swedish Massage?

Swedish massage is a relaxing, full-body massage that uses slow, gentle movements to help your muscles loosen up. It focuses on improving overall comfort and calmness rather than using strong pressure.

The therapist usually uses:

  • Long, smooth strokes
  • Light to medium pressure
  • Circular motions
  • Soft tapping
  • Gentle kneading
  • These movements help your body release tension and improve blood flow.

What Happens During a Swedish Massage?

If you’ve never had one before, here’s what to expect:

  • You talk to the therapist about areas you want relaxed.
  • You lie on a massage table under a warm sheet.
  • The therapist uses gentle oil to help their hands glide smoothly.
  • They use soft, flowing strokes over the whole body.
  • You may even fall asleep — that’s how relaxing it is!
  • Swedish massage usually lasts 60 to 90 minutes, depending on what you prefer.

 

10 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About Swedish Massage

1. Is Swedish massage painful?

No! Swedish massage uses light to medium pressure. It is meant to be gentle and relaxing, not painful.

2. How long is a Swedish massage session?

Most sessions last 60 minutes, but many people choose 90 minutes for a deeper relaxation experience.

3. Is Swedish massage good for everyone?

Yes, it is safe for almost everyone, including beginners, older adults, and people who prefer gentle treatment.

4. Can Swedish massage help reduce stress?

Absolutely. It is one of the best massages for lowering stress and calming the mind.

5. Will I feel sleepy after the massage?

Many people feel sleepy or deeply relaxed afterward — this is normal and a good sign.

6. What should I wear?

You undress to your comfort level and stay covered with a sheet. Only the part being massaged is uncovered.

7. Does Swedish massage help with pain?

It helps with mild to moderate muscle pain and tension. For stronger pain, deep tissue massage may be better.

8. Can it help with headaches?

Yes! It relaxes neck and shoulder muscles, which often reduces headaches.

9. How often should I get Swedish massage?

For relaxation, once every 3–4 weeks is good.
For stress relief, once a week can be very helpful.

10. Will I be sore afterward?

Usually not. Swedish massage is gentle, so you rarely feel sore afterward.
